About this ebook
Sexy, handsome men like Grant Whittaker rarely walked through the doors of the middle school where Dr. Kelly Riley worked as an Asst. Principal. In her mind, staring at him was justified. When she learns that he’s a local politician running for office and practicing his oratory skills on her students she’s interested. But when she discovers her son is gay and her lover is running on a conservative ticket, she makes the only decision she feels she can and leaves Grant behind.
Former professional football player Grant Whittaker wasn’t accustomed to women correcting him or dismissing him either. Both things happen within five minutes of meeting the stunning Dr. Riley. After she agrees to go on a date with him, he knows she is the woman he wants to spend the rest of his life with. But she disappears without explanation. The next time he sees her, his emotions churn out of control and he says hurtful things, pushing them further apart.
Grant and Kelly are both thrown mega-sized curve balls and must come to grips with a new way of looking at life if they are to hold their families together. Sometimes accepting what you cannot change is more than a poem, or a few scattered words, it’s a decree. There comes a time when Letting Go is all you can do, to free yourself to love.

- Rating: 4 out of 5 stars4/5I really liked this book, and thought that both the adults' relationship and the teenagers' sexual identities were well handled. I think this novel was informative and believable, but managed to avoid sounding preachy. I will definitely read more of this author's works.
- Rating: 3 out of 5 stars3/5an ok read, nothing too exciting. without saying too much; it centred mainly around the gay aspect, not so much the relationship between the H/h. when I read the sample, I was excited to read the full book but was left "wanting".
